会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
于是张
精神不灭,则万物兴亦。
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
5
6
···
11
下一页
2022年11月2日
Invalid bound statement (not found) mybatis问题
摘要: 碰到Invalid bound statement (not found)问题 1.首先排查扫描包名称是否正确,Mapper 引用。 2.检查传入参数类型是否正确。 一般问题都是自己编写或生成文件的问题。
阅读全文
posted @ 2022-11-02 13:49 老小包的博客
阅读(40)
评论(0)
推荐(0)
2022年10月24日
list根据条件remove元素
摘要: 问题:list通过增强for循环或者for循环又或者流形式遍历会导致 outofsize 下标越界问题 解决方式:通过迭代方式实现 实现: //遍历明细Iterator<UserGroupDetail> it = userGroupDetails.iterator();while(it.hasNex
阅读全文
posted @ 2022-10-24 16:51 老小包的博客
阅读(58)
评论(0)
推荐(0)
2022年9月28日
排查线上内存泄露问题 oom
摘要: 近期项目活动总是出现莫名其妙的中断,查看日志发现 竟然报出oom Java heap space 发现原来是oom终止了进程导致 由此推断出是内存溢出 或者是内存泄露 第一步:就是找到运维要hprof文件 获取文件后 使用mat工具打开进行分析 下载https://www.eclipse.org/m
阅读全文
posted @ 2022-09-28 16:42 老小包的博客
阅读(145)
评论(0)
推荐(0)
2022年9月21日
关于重定向session丢失避坑
摘要: 起因:老数据进行重构迁移升级框架,嵌入企微内部,运用重定向页面,filter拦截请求进行权限控制,本地部署使用一切正常,但是一放置在k8s中会导致session丢失,而产生多次调用,而企微code5分钟内只能获取一次客户信息,问题产生。 1.排查问题 误区一 认为企微多次回调导致,多次请求实际为页面
阅读全文
posted @ 2022-09-21 15:11 老小包的博客
阅读(588)
评论(0)
推荐(0)
2022年8月17日
BootstrapValidator 表单验证超详细教程
摘要: https://www.cnblogs.com/keepruning/p/9153545.html
阅读全文
posted @ 2022-08-17 15:06 老小包的博客
阅读(166)
评论(0)
推荐(0)
2022年6月23日
@Retryable spring重试注解使用
摘要: 在类上增加@Retryable注解 application 增加@EnableRetryable注解 value 判断何种报错 maxAttempts指最大重试次数 backoff 为延时时间 代码实例 int i=0;long startTime = System.currentTimeMilli
阅读全文
posted @ 2022-06-23 16:42 老小包的博客
阅读(149)
评论(0)
推荐(0)
@Async @Retryable @Transactional 内部使用失效aop问题解决
摘要: 问题原因:由于aop动态代丽问题,注解实例获取为代理类,导致注解不能正常使用导致此问题。 解决思路:手动获取实体类进行执行,使用application.getBean()方式获取 代码: @Slf4j@Componentpublic class SpringContextUtil implement
阅读全文
posted @ 2022-06-23 16:39 老小包的博客
阅读(937)
评论(0)
推荐(0)
2022年4月21日
python 从文件下载lib包
摘要: pip install -r xxxx.txt -i http://nexus.xxxxx.com/repository/pypi-group/simple --trusted-host nexus.xxxxxx.com --target=./lib
阅读全文
posted @ 2022-04-21 17:13 老小包的博客
阅读(229)
评论(0)
推荐(0)
2022年3月18日
lambda表达式各种用法
摘要: 根据姓名去除list中已包含的该姓名的数据list = list.stream().filter(one-> !one.getUserInfo().contains(one.getName())).collect(Collectors.toList());遍历mapmap.forEach((k.v)
阅读全文
posted @ 2022-03-18 14:11 老小包的博客
阅读(33)
评论(0)
推荐(0)
2022年3月15日
数组 list互转
摘要: int[] data = {4, 5, 3, 6, 2, 5, 1}; // int[] 转 List<Integer> List<Integer> list1 = Arrays.stream(data).boxed().collect(Collectors.toList()); // Arrays
阅读全文
posted @ 2022-03-15 15:57 老小包的博客
阅读(137)
评论(0)
推荐(0)
上一页
1
2
3
4
5
6
···
11
下一页
公告